Abstract

The utility model relates to an intelligent automobile fire extinguishing device, which belongs to the technical field of automobile fire extinguishing devices and comprises a first folding frame, a first push rod, a plurality of first fire extinguishing nozzles, two first motors and two first rotating wheels. The fixed end of the first push rod is hinged to one horizontal end of the first folding frame, and the telescopic end is hinged to the other horizontal end of the first folding frame; the multiple first fire extinguishing nozzles are fixed to the bottom end of the first folding frame at intervals. The two first motors are fixed to the two ends of the first folding frame in the horizontal direction correspondingly. The two first rotating wheels are fixedly arranged on output shafts of the two first motors in a sleeving mode correspondingly. The length of the first folding frame is adjusted according to the width of the tunnel, so that the two first rotating wheels are in contact with the two opposite inner side walls of the tunnel respectively; then two first motors are started, so that two first rotating wheels rotate, and the position of the automobile fire extinguishing device in the tunnel is autonomously moved; and finally, the multiple first fire extinguishing nozzles are started to spray water or fire extinguishing agents towards the automobile fire, the fire extinguishing nozzles lifted by hands of firefighters can be replaced, and fire extinguishing in narrow areas is adapted.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the technical field of automotive fire extinguishing devices, and in particular to an intelligent automotive fire extinguishing device. Background Technology

[0002] In recent years, my country's electric vehicle ownership has grown rapidly. As of June 2022, global cumulative sales of electric vehicles have exceeded 20 million units, while my country's electric vehicle market penetration rate has exceeded 21.6%, with a total ownership exceeding 11 million units. Due to the characteristics of electric vehicle lithium batteries, such as rapid combustion, high risk of reignition, and difficulty in disposal, research on their combustion characteristics is necessary.

[0003] Currently, traditional fire extinguishing devices can only extinguish car fires in open areas (such as roads and parking lots). However, in narrow areas, such as tunnels, alleys, lanes, and underground parking lots, the limited operating space and difficulty in extinguishing fires make it difficult for firefighters to enter or significantly increases the risk of fire once they enter. This results in the fire extinguishing devices being unable to be deployed in a timely and effective manner, causing a significant reduction in their fire extinguishing performance and making it difficult to extinguish car fires.

[0004] Therefore, how to design an intelligent vehicle fire extinguishing device that can autonomously navigate and move its location, has high fire extinguishing efficiency and safety, and is applicable to various narrow areas is a problem that urgently needs to be solved by those skilled in the art. Utility Model Content

[0005] This invention provides an intelligent vehicle fire extinguishing device that solves the technical problem that existing fire extinguishing devices are not suitable for narrow areas.

[0006] The technical solution of this utility model to solve the above-mentioned technical problems is as follows: an intelligent car fire extinguishing device, comprising: a first folding frame, a first push rod, multiple first extinguishing nozzles with adjustable spray angles, two first motors, and two first rotating wheels.

[0007] The first folding frame is arranged horizontally; the fixed end of the first push rod is hinged to one end of the first folding frame in the horizontal direction and its telescopic end is hinged to the other end of the first folding frame in the horizontal direction; a plurality of first fire extinguishing nozzles are fixed at intervals at the bottom end of the first folding frame and their spray direction is downward; two first motors are respectively fixed at both ends of the first folding frame in the horizontal direction and their output shafts are arranged in the height direction; two first rotating wheels are respectively fixed on the output shafts of the two first motors to drive the first folding frame to move in the tunnel, so as to facilitate the use of multiple first fire extinguishing nozzles to extinguish car fires in the tunnel.

[0008] The beneficial effects of this utility model are: it improves the structure of traditional fire extinguishing devices. First, the length of the first folding frame is adjusted according to the tunnel width so that the two first rotating wheels contact the two inner walls of the tunnel respectively. Then, the two first motors are started to make the two first rotating wheels rotate and move the car fire extinguishing device to the position inside the tunnel autonomously. Finally, multiple first fire extinguishing nozzles, which are all connected to the external water source or fire extinguishing agent, are started to spray water or fire extinguishing agent at the car fire. This can replace the fire extinguishing nozzles held by firefighters and is suitable for efficient fire extinguishing in narrow areas such as tunnels.

[0009] Based on the above technical solution, the present invention can be further improved as follows.

[0010] Furthermore, it also includes a second folding frame, multiple second fire extinguishing nozzles with adjustable spray angles, a second push rod, a second motor, and a second rotating wheel. The top end of the second folding frame is detachably connected to or rotatably connected to one end of the first folding frame in the horizontal direction via an electric rotary connector. Multiple second fire extinguishing nozzles are fixed at intervals on the second folding frame. The top end of the second push rod is hinged to the top end of the second folding frame, and its telescopic end is hinged to the bottom end of the second folding frame. The second motor is fixed to the bottom end of the second folding frame, and its output shaft is arranged in the horizontal direction. The second rotating wheel is sleeved on the output shaft of the second motor to drive the first folding frame and the second folding frame to move in the alley, facilitating the use of multiple first fire extinguishing nozzles and multiple second fire extinguishing nozzles to extinguish car fires in the alley.

[0011] The further beneficial effect of adopting the above is that by detachably connecting the top of the second folding frame to one end of the first folding frame in the horizontal direction or rotating it through an electric rotary connector, the car fire extinguishing device can be adjusted into an L-shaped structure, which is suitable for extinguishing car fires in narrow alleys or alleys.

[0012] Furthermore, it also includes a third folding frame, multiple third fire extinguishing nozzles with adjustable spray angles, a third push rod, a third motor, and a third rotating wheel. The top end of the third folding frame is detachably connected to or rotatably connected to the other end of the first folding frame in the horizontal direction via an electric rotary connector. The multiple third fire extinguishing nozzles are fixed at intervals on the third folding frame. The top end of the third push rod intersects with the top end of the third folding frame, and its telescopic end is hinged to the bottom end of the third folding frame. The third motor is fixed to the bottom end of the third folding frame, and its output shaft is arranged in the horizontal direction. The third rotating wheel is sleeved on the output shaft of the third motor to drive the first folding frame, the second folding frame, and the third folding frame to move in the tunnel, the alley, or the road, facilitating the use of multiple first fire extinguishing nozzles and multiple third fire extinguishing nozzles to extinguish vehicle fires in the tunnel, the alley, or the road.

[0013] The further beneficial effects of adopting the above are: by using the first folding frame, the second folding frame and the third folding frame to form an inverted U-shaped structure, it can adapt to a relatively spacious area, and the car fire can be placed inside the car fire extinguishing device, thereby improving the fire extinguishing efficiency and preventing the car fire from igniting surrounding objects.

[0014] Furthermore, it also includes a fire extinguishing agent storage tank, a battery, a camera, a radar, and a remote controller. The fire extinguishing agent storage tank is fixed on the first folding frame, the second folding frame, or the third folding frame and is respectively connected to a plurality of first fire extinguishing nozzles, a plurality of second fire extinguishing nozzles, and a plurality of third fire extinguishing nozzles. The camera and the radar are fixed at intervals on the first folding frame, the second folding frame, or the third folding frame. The battery is fixed on the first folding frame, the second folding frame, or the third folding frame and is respectively electrically connected to the first push rod, a plurality of first fire extinguishing nozzles, two first motors, a plurality of second fire extinguishing nozzles, a second push rod, a second motor, a plurality of third fire extinguishing nozzles, a third push rod, a third motor, the camera, and the radar. The remote controller is communicatively connected to the first push rod, a plurality of first fire extinguishing nozzles, two first motors, a plurality of second fire extinguishing nozzles, a second push rod, a second motor, a plurality of third fire extinguishing nozzles, a third push rod, and a third motor via a power control line, Bluetooth, or Wi-Fi.

[0015] The further beneficial effect of adopting the above is that by using cameras and radar to identify road condition information and transmitting the road condition information to a remote control terminal, the position of the car fire extinguishing device can be remotely controlled, thus avoiding danger to firefighters.

[0016] Furthermore, it also includes a temperature sensor, which is fixed on the first folding frame; the battery is electrically connected to the temperature sensor; and the remote controller communicates with the temperature sensor via a power control line, Bluetooth, or Wi-Fi.

[0017] The further beneficial effect of adopting the above is that by using a temperature sensor to sense the temperature of a car fire in real time and transmitting the temperature information to a remote controller, the fire extinguishing device of the car can be remotely controlled to adjust the amount of fire extinguishing agent sprayed, so as to avoid insufficient or excessive fire extinguishing agent spraying in a car fire.

[0018] Furthermore, it also includes a smoke sensor, which is fixed on the first folding frame; the battery is electrically connected to the smoke sensor; and the remote controller communicates with the smoke sensor via a power control line, Bluetooth, or Wi-Fi.

[0019] Furthermore, it also includes a GPS locator and a navigator, wherein the GPS locator and the navigator are fixed at intervals on the first folding frame, the second folding frame, or the third folding frame; the battery is electrically connected to the GPS locator and the navigator; and the remote controller is communicatively connected to the GPS locator and the navigator.

[0020] The further beneficial effect of adopting the above is that by using GPS positioning and navigation to communicate with the remote controller, the vehicle fire extinguishing device can be remotely controlled to move autonomously and avoid obstacles, thereby improving the intelligence of the vehicle fire extinguishing device.

[0021] Furthermore, it also includes an audible and visual alarm, which is fixed on the first folding frame, the second folding frame, or the third folding frame; the battery is electrically connected to the audible and visual alarm; and the remote controller is communicatively connected to the audible and visual alarm.

[0022] Furthermore, it also includes a fireproof cloth, which is placed over the first folding frame, the second folding frame, and the third folding frame. Attached Figure Description
